    24A, DRYDEN ROAD, LONDON, SW19 8SG

    This terraced leasehold property on Dryden Road last sold in February 2022 for £590,000. Based on price growth in the SW19 district since then, its estimated current value is £581,146 — placing it in the 85th percentile nationally and the 46th percentile within SW19. The property covers 101 m² (1,087 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£5,754 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— SW19

    SW19 covers Wimbledon and surrounding neighbourhoods in south-west London. It is an affluent, family-oriented area with strong professional employment and high property values.
